Population in July 2008: 751. Population change since 2000: +15.9%
 

Males: 351  (46.8%)
Females: 400  (53.2%)

Median resident age:  35.4 years
Delaware median age:  36.0 years

Zip codes: 19946.


Estimated median household income in 2008: $42,123 (it was $30,781 in 2000)
Frederica:  $42,123
Delaware:  $57,989

Estimated per capita income in 2008: $18,385

Estimated median house or condo value in 2008: $152,977 (it was $73,500 in 2000)
Frederica:  $152,977
Delaware:  $250,900

Frederica-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Delaware state average. It is 0%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 6/9/1977, a category 2 (max. wind speeds 113-157 mph) tornado 1.5 miles away from the Frederica town center injured one person and ca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.

On 7/31/1992, a category 2 tornado 2.4 miles away from the town center ca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.


Frederica-area historical earthquake activity is significantly below Delaware state average. It is 97%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 1/16/1994 at 01:49:16, a magnitude 4.6 (4.6 MB, 4.6 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: IV - V) earthquake occurred 96.3 miles away from Frederica center
On 1/16/1994 at 00:42:43, a magnitude 4.2 (4.2 MB, 4.0 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 95.6 miles away from the city center
On 10/23/1990 at 01:34:48, a magnitude 3.2 (2.9 LG, 3.2 MD, Depth: 6.2 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: II - III) earthquake occurred 34.9 miles away from the city center
On 11/14/1997 at 03:44:11, a magnitude 3.0 (3.0 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 89.1 miles away from Frederica center
Magnitude types: regional Lg-wave magnitude (LG), body-wave magnitude (MB), duration magnitude (MD)
